Best West Warwick Private Schools (2026)

For the 2026 school year, there are 6 private schools serving 613 students in West Warwick, RI (there are 6 public schools, serving 3,423 public students). 15% of all K-12 students in West Warwick, RI are educated in private schools (compared to the RI state average of 14%).
The top-ranked private school in West Warwick, RI is St. Joseph School.
The average acceptance rate is 90%, which is higher than the Rhode Island private school average acceptance rate of 77%.
33% of private schools in West Warwick, RI are religiously affiliated (most commonly Islamic and Catholic).
